Stink bug eggs are usually barrel-shaped, and white to pale green, depending on the species. Females lay eggs on the underside of the leaves of their host plant. These eggs are usually laid in clusters of between 20 and 30, but 28 is the average. The population was so ...The Harlequin Cabbage Bug (Murgantia histrionica) is a colorful agricultural pest affecting plants in the Brassica family. They lay black or dark brown barrel-shaped eggs in clusters of 10-12 on leaf undersides, often near veins. Eggs hatch in 4-7 days, and nymphs emerge with bright colors similar to adults.Stick insects lay eggs that appear like seeds. They are also a pervasive pantry pest. Granary weevils are around 0.08–0.12 inch (2–3 millimeters) long with a polished, reddish-brown color. They have an elongated snout that is about one-quarter the length of its entire body. Adult large milkweed bugs ( Oncopeltus fasciatus) are ¾” long, orange to reddish-orange, with a black band across their back. The nymphs and adults will feed on milkweed, particularly the seeds, and are commonly found clustering on plants' seed pods.
